Kuasai objek terbina dalam PHP: Untuk mempelajari pengendalian dan penggunaan objek terbina dalam yang biasa digunakan, contoh kod khusus diperlukan
PHP, sebagai bahasa pembangunan bahagian belakang yang digunakan secara meluas, menyediakan banyak terbina dalam yang berkuasa objek yang boleh membantu kami Membangunkan dan mengurus tapak web dengan cekap. Menguasai operasi dan penggunaan objek terbina dalam ini adalah penting untuk pembangun PHP. Artikel ini akan memperkenalkan beberapa objek terbina dalam PHP yang biasa digunakan dan memberikan contoh kod khusus.
1. Objek pemprosesan rentetan (String)
Pemprosesan rentetan sering digunakan dalam pembangunan web PHP menyediakan objek pemprosesan rentetan yang kuat yang boleh melakukan operasi seperti penambahan, pemadaman, pengubahsuaian dan pertanyaan rentetan. Berikut adalah beberapa kaedah pemprosesan rentetan yang biasa digunakan:
$str = "Hello, world!"; $length = strlen($str); echo "字符串的长度为:" . $length;
Hasil keluaran ialah: Panjang rentetan ialah: 13
$str = "Hello, world!"; $subStr = substr($str, 0, 5); echo "截取的子字符串为:" . $subStr;
$str = "Hello, world!"; $newStr = str_replace("world", "PHP", $str); echo "替换后的字符串为:" . $newStr;
Pemerolehan panjang tatasusunan (kiraan)
$arr = array("apple", "banana", "orange"); $length = count($arr); echo "数组的长度为:" . $length;
Keluaran lintasan tatasusunan (foreach)
$arr = array("apple", "banana", "orange"); foreach ($arr as $value) { echo $value . " "; }
$arr = array("apple", "banana", "orange"); array_push($arr, "grape"); foreach ($arr as $value) { echo $value . " "; }
Pemprosesan tarikh dan masa sering digunakan dalam pembangunan web, dan PHP menyediakan objek pemprosesan Tarikh dan masa boleh melakukan operasi seperti pemformatan dan pengiraan tarikh dan masa. Berikut adalah beberapa kaedah pemprosesan tarikh dan masa yang biasa digunakan:
Dapatkan tarikh dan masa semasa (tarikh)$currentTime = date("Y-m-d H:i:s"); echo "当前日期时间为:" . $currentTime;
$dateTime = new DateTime('2021-11-30 10:30:00'); $formattedDateTime = $dateTime->format('Y-m-d H:i:s'); echo "格式化后的日期时间为:" . $formattedDateTime;
Perbandingan tarikh dan masa (DateTimerr)
Ringkasan:
Atas ialah kandungan terperinci Belajar menggunakan objek terbina dalam PHP biasa: kuasai operasi dan penggunaan objek terbina dalam.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!